World ranking: In the 2019 QS World University Rankings: Accounting and Finance, six (6) Australian universities were cited in the Top 50 band.  Total of seventeen (11) Australian universities was cited in the Top 200: 2019 QS World University Rankings: Accounting and Finance.

The Times Higher Education World University Rankings 2019 has cited twenty-four (24) Australian universities in the Top 500 band.

Accreditation: There are three (3) professional accounting bodies for accountants in Australia: CPA Australia, Institute of Chartered Accountants and Institute of Public Accountants. Completing an accredited degree is the recognized pathway to associate membership to CPA Australia and the Institute of Chartered Accountants.

Bright future: Due to the high demand for Accounting graduates and as with other sectors of accountancy, these occupations are listed consistently in the Skilled Occupations List (SOL) and Consolidated Sponsored Occupations List (CSOL).  Sample of which are Accountant (General), Management Accountant, Taxation Accountant, External Auditor, Financial Investment Manager. As most visa types, an assessment procedure by a recognized authority for is required as part of the visa application for work sponsorship or migration purpose such as Permanent Residency.
